Effort-LESS


CLEVELAND, OHIO - Tonight the Cavs showed some real backbone by coming home after a big road victory and getting smoked by the Orlando Magic. Lebron led the sissies in wine and gold with 18 points and 5 assists (More importantly, he stayed hot from the free throw stripe going 6 of 13). I'm especially proud of Big Z, who came out tonight and really made a statement (5 points on 2 of 5 from the floor, with 4 personal fouls and a lacerated eye). Even more impressive were the fans in attendance who I don't think muttered a cheer or even bothered to get out of their seats once (Although who could blame them watching this lifeless team). The highlights of the game included Lebron going 1 of 5 shooting Michael Jordan's patented turn around jumper, and Darko Milicic going baseline and stuffing home a dunk that could have easily been prevented by something high-school coaches call weak side help.
